摘要
The screw dislocation interacting with a nanoscale cylindrical inclusion in an elastic half-plane is analyzed. The boundary condition at the interface between the inclusion and the matrix is modified by incorporating surface/interface stress. The explicit expression of the image force acting on the screw dislocation is obtained. The mobility and the equilibrium positions of the dislocation near to the inclusion are discussed. The results indicate that the elastic interference of the screw dislocation and a nanoscale cylindrical inclusion is strongly influenced by the half-plane surface. Comparing with the solution of screw dislocation and nano-inclusion in the whole plane, we can observe that more equilibrium positions of the dislocation may be available and only exist at the y-axis. On the other hand, the image force exerted on the dislocation may be complex than in the whole plane case which dependent on the half-plane surface attracting the screw dislocation.
